Key Responsibilities:

  • Conduct start-up safety checks on all assigned machines/assets.
  • Understand all risk assessments and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) for all activities under your control.
  • Proactively seek, raise & rectify safety risks and promote positive safety behaviours.
  • Work cross-functionally with other Process Leads to ensure optimal performance.
  • Support the training of team members within the line you are supporting.
  • Support priority problem-solving activities within area of control.
  • Track, record and display performance versus target of the line.
  • Use problem solving to deal with issues that may prevent team members from completing their work to standard.
  • Record all information required for area of control, including time, temperature, weight, product traceability, KPIs, equipment condition etc.
  • Run assigned area/asset/line to standard using; 5S, Work Element Sheets (WES), SOPs and other standards.
  • Conduct layered confirmation to confirm standards are in place and effective.
  • Use visual management to support the Production Group Manager in communicating performance.
  • Track attainment to plan (ATP) and trigger the escalation process for any deviation in safety, quality, environment, service or throughput.
  • Ensure that start-ups and changeovers are documented, planned, and executed efficiently to minimise cost.
  • Ensure that poor quality is never passed on to the next stage of the process.
  • Conduct quality checks as required.
  • Support investigation of quality non-conformances, customer complaints or other issues.
  • Conduct regular preventative maintenance on all machines as directed by Engineering.

Our Requirements:

  • Listens to others and builds trust among team members and colleagues.
  • Role model of the PART behaviours.
  • Knowledge of Health & Safety, Food Safety, Food Quality and Environment requirements.
  • Good knowledge of machine operation and optimisation.
  • Working knowledge of verbal and written English.
  • Passionate, adaptable individual with a ‘Can do’ & ‘hands-on’ attitude.
